2010 Census: Yonkers Will Be The Third Largest City In New York – If YOU Return Your Census Form!

                                                                   yonkers-census-flyer                                  This year Yonkers has a real chance to become the third largest city in New York. Since the City has been shortchanged for many years by Albany this only strengthens our argument to get the money that we are justly entitled to. You may not realize that the census is not just some annoyance that pops up every ten years. I actually mean hundreds of millions of dollars in government aid over the next decade. But if you do not return your form, we do not get the money! It is really quite simple, no form, no $$.

I have been appointed by Mayor Amicone to the Yonkers Census Board for 2010, and it my job to help coax the form out of your hands, and into the mail box. I am not an “enumerator;” the people who ill knock on your door up to six times this summer to follow up if you do not send your form in. The Census Board was formed to help get the word out, and to help YOU in making sure you return your form.

Perhaps the biggest concern people have is privacy. Did you know your information is kept confidential for 72 years? That mean in 2012 the data from the census taken in 1940 will be released! Title 13, Sections 9 and 214 of the United States Code keep your information confidential; the information cannot be obtained by law enforcement, the courts, the IRS, and cannot be obtained by a FOIA (Freedom of Information Act) request.
